In Odesa, a condominium association installed a solar power plant on its building at the expense of the state

Residents of the association received co-financing of this project under the "GreenDIM" program

Odesa-based condominium Zadiak has completed the installation of a solar power plant on the roof of its 12-storey building, which will now provide for the general electricity supply needs of the building.

This was reported by the Energy Efficiency Fund.

The solar power plant has a capacity of 25 kW and will be able to support the operation of elevators, lighting, water and heat pumps, video surveillance systems and intercoms during power outages. Along with the solar panels, the co-owners installed an inverter with a total capacity of 30 kW and batteries that accumulate more than 30 kW.

“We were able to implement a project that exceeded all our expectations. Now we have significant savings, because we use solar energy exclusively during the day and switch to centralized electricity supply in the evening,” says Alla Bondar, chairman of Zadiak HOA.

The main indicators of the "Zadiak" condominium project:

  • the total cost of measures compensated by the Energy Efficiency Fund is UAH 1.3 million, of which UAH 971,000 is a grant paid by the fund;
  • The cost of works for one apartment was about 3 thousand. UAH

Projected savings:

  • annual cost savings for the electricity needs of the entire building – UAH 95,000;
  • annual energy savings for the needs of the entire house – 22 thousand kWh/year.
